NORTON, MA (February 21, 2026) - The Tufts University men's indoor track & field team posted the best marks in six events while competing at the Wheaton Post-Season Qualifier on Saturday.
The team's top-ranked performance came from freshman
Jack Davis, who won 200 meters in a time of 22.17 seconds. Converted from the flat track at Wheaton to a banked-track time for national ranking purposes, it's a 21.78 mark that is just outside of the top 50 in Division III.
Senior
Cullen McCaleb was first out of 17 in the mile run today. His 4:12.47 time converted from the flat track to a banked-track mark of 4:09.29, which just missed improving his national-qualifying time (4:09.24).
Junior
Sami Witta won the high jump, clearing 1.97m (6'5 ½") on his best attempt, while sophomore
Alejandro Rincon was first in the pole vault with a 4.45m (14'7 ¼") mark. It's his PR and gets him into the Tufts top 10 all-time. Senior
Tre Williams added another field event victory with his 16.51m (54'2) distance in the weight throw.
Also on the track today, Tufts junior
Brady Kamali won the 400 meters Invitational race with a time of 50.84 seconds. Sophomore
Evan Hankins was the fastest of the 14 runners to finish the 800 meters with a 1:59.20 time.
Junior Charlie Fitzpatrick lowered his PR in the 60-meter dash to 7.00 seconds, the team's best time of the year and giving him the #6 all-time ranking among Jumbos. He was second in the race out of 38 sprinters. Davis had a 7.04 time for third place and to get him into Tufts' top 10 for the event. Freshman
Zachary Tang tied his season-best (7.09) in the race.
Williams was also the Tufts leader in the shot put with a 13.64m (44'9") best throw that took fifth place. Senior
Martin Decker was fourth in the weight throw (14.36m - 47'1 ½").
Freshman
Eliot Monick ran third in the 200-meter Invitational (23.02), while Tang was fourth in the race (23.08). Senior
Sam Nissen's 24.15 in the open 200 run was his PR. Senior
Matt Burdulis added a 9:11.91 for third in the 3000 meters.
The Jumbos will compete at the New England Division III Men's Indoor Track & Field Championships next weekend at The TRACK at New Balance Friday through Sunday (Feb. 27 - Mar. 1).
